Transparent samba share

Alexandros Kosiaris alex at noc.ntua.gr
Sun Nov 26 22:03:04 EET 2006


Tasos Laskos wrote:
> Hehehe, ayti ti stigmi asxoloume kai ego me SMB shares.
> Ta kano mount, os root logika, alla meta mono o root exei write access
> sto mount point asxetos ti permissions eixe to mount point prin to
> mount.
> 
> chown de doyleyei episis...
> 
> Epelpistika tora kai esvisa ola ta confs, 8a ta grapso pali from scratch....
> 
Και για το δικό σου προβληματάκι υπάρχει λύση.

man smbmount

uid=<arg>
     sets the uid that will own all files on the mounted filesystem. It may be 
specified as either a username or a numeric uid.
gid=<arg>
     sets the gid that will own all files on the mounted filesystem. It may be 
specified as either a groupname or a numeric gid.

fmask=<arg>
     sets the file mask. This determines the permissions that remote files have in 
the local filesystem. This is not a umask, but the actual permissions for the 
files. The default is based on the current umask.
dmask=<arg>
     Sets the directory mask. This determines the permissions that remote 
directories have in the local filesystem. This is not a umask, but the actual 
permissions for the directories. The default is based on the current umask.

Διαλέγεις και παίρνεις. Προσωπικώς εκτός και έαν σηκώνω production environment 
προτιμώ απλά να λέω ένα uid=alex και να ξεμπλέκω μία και καλή.

Παρεπτιπτόντως ίσως να σε βολεύει ιδιαίτερα να χρησιμοποιείς τα options  που στο 
προηγούμενο mail του είπε ο Νίκος, δηλαδή τα:

iocharset=utf8,dir_mode=0700,file_mode=0600,uid=1000,gid=1000

> Gia to provlima sou (os root) :
> 
> mount -t smbfs //<domain name or IP address>/<share name> <mount point>
> 
> 
> On 11/17/06, Nick Demou <ndemou at gmail.com> wrote:
>> transparent samba share? μα αυτό που περιγράφεις είναι ένα κλασικό
>> samba share που δημιουργείς κάνοντας mount το samba share στο τοπικό
>> filesystem (όπως όλα τα filesystems δηλαδή).
>> Πρέπει να μελετήσεις λίγο το smbfs ή ίσως καλύτερα το cifs. Ορήστε ένα
>> παράδειγμα από το δικό μου PC (στην περίπτωση μου είναι μια γραμμή από
>> το fstab αλλά γίνεται και με την εντολή mount αν δεν θες να είναι
>> μόνιμο):
>>
>> //samba_host_name/share      /data/win        cifs
>> credentials=/root/.smbcredentials,iocharset=utf8,dir_mode=0700,file_mode=0600,uid=1000,gid=1000
>>  0      0
>>
>> σχετικά με το smbfs:// Αυτό υποστηρίζεται μόνο από μερικούς
>> filebrowsers και ίσως σε κανα δυο άλλα προγράμματα - δεν είναι κάτι
>> καθολικό σαν το http://
>>
>>
>> --
>> linux-greek-users mailing list -- http://lists.hellug.gr
> 
> 


-- 
Alexandros Kosiaris     Network Management Center , NTUA
e-mail : alex at noc.ntua.gr
Public Key Fingerprint :
D6B1 0634 BE65 719C 6C95  7492 8201 4B46 C478 F074
-------------- next part --------------
A non-text attachment was scrubbed...
Name: smime.p7s
Type: application/x-pkcs7-signature
Size: 5152 bytes
Desc: S/MIME Cryptographic Signature
URL: <http://lists.hellug.gr/pipermail/linux-greek-users/attachments/20061126/06a3315e/attachment.bin>


More information about the Linux-greek-users mailing list